How to Search for an Accountant
Every small business start with you doing all the number works. You may opt to do it manually with just some pen, paper, and your trusted calculator or probably get some help from online accounting software. However, as your business grows, so are the numbers that you need to balance and you may start finding yourself lost from all those digits. Since each of those digits represents money – debit or credit, you need to make sure that you have them all balanced out. When this happens, you might need the expert help of accountants.
If you have finally decided that you need an accountant’s help, your next task is searching for accountants that you can trust. Here’s how:
#1 Make a shortlist
To do this, you may opt to ask for your close family and friends’ referrals or search the internet. Do get their name, contact number, office address, and their website (if available).
#2 Call or meet the accountants in your list
Your conversation should include questions regarding their experience – Do they have clients in the same field as you do? Can they take care of your business?; Fees – How much do they charge? What does that charges cover?; Personnel – Who will you be working with most of the time, himself or a partner? Choose about three to five accountants to meet.
#3 Check credentials
Before you close the deal and hire them, make sure that they are duly licensed by the state to practice. Meet them in their office so you’ll know where to find them. You may also check with the Better Business Bureau (BBB) if they are registered. Finally, asks for two to three references which you can call and asks about them. Call these references and asks for a personal feedback.
#4 Professionalism
Always do a background check on your soon to be personal accountant. Know his/her records and always take note if you are comfortable being with him/her as your accountant. This is very important because your accountant is responsible to the financial matters in your firm or business.
